The patch looks good.
Speed is really the only reason the paths were being restricted to
lowercase; I didn't think ppl would be that concerned with case in their
dfs topology.
Anyway, the next step would be to use the results of RESOLVE_DFSPATH all
over to prevent unix_convert being called twice for local pathnames.
